When collecting combustible dust from battery manufacturing, anti-static and fire-retardant filter materials may be advised. The dust collection system for battery dust must be designed in accordance with all OSHA regulations and NFPA standards for collection of combustible dust.
In battery manufacturing, effective dust collection is crucial for maintaining a clean and safe working environment. Dust generated during processes such as electrode production and battery assembly can compromise product quality, reduce production efficiency, and pose serious health risks to workers.
The dust generated during the production process can come from a variety of sources, such as the mixing of powders, the cutting of electrodes, or the handling of raw materials. Many battery chemistries rely on materials with very high energy densities, meaning they store a lot of energy in a small space.
Battery manufacturing for electric vehicles (EVs) and other applications produces toxic and combustible dust at many points in the process. Effective dust control is critical to protect people, processes and product quality. Dust collection solutions for battery manufacturing are never a “one size fits all” proposition.
Dust can contaminate production materials and interfere with the battery production process, leading to a range of quality issues such as: Inconsistent Performance: Dust contamination can cause inconsistencies in the battery production process, leading to variations in battery performance and reliability.
